Finding the right table light for studying in Singapore involves evaluating how different brands address visual comfort, desk space, and modern connectivity. While Philips, Xiaomi, and BenQ are all prominent names in the lighting market, they approach study illumination from distinct angles. Philips emphasizes traditional optical comfort and physical ergonomics, Xiaomi focuses on smart home integration and minimalist value, and BenQ targets premium, wide-angle optical engineering. Rather than searching for a single universal winner, you should focus on matching each brand’s design philosophy to your specific study habits, desk layout, and budget.
Key Specifications to Verify for Study Lighting
Before comparing brands, you must understand the technical specifications listed on product packaging. Illuminance, measured in lux, indicates how much light actually reaches your desk surface. For intensive reading and writing, look for a lamp that delivers adequate lux at the center of the workspace, with a wide, uniform spread that prevents high-contrast dark spots.
The Color Rendering Index (CRI), denoted as Ra, measures how accurately a light source reveals the true colors of objects compared to natural daylight. For studying, verify a CRI rating of Ra 90 or higher on the label, which helps reduce eye strain when reading colored diagrams, textbooks, or physical notes.

Flicker and glare control are critical for preventing visual fatigue during long study sessions. Check the product specifications for certified flicker-free technology and low-blue-light labels from recognized testing bodies. Additionally, look for physical design features like honeycomb diffusers or asymmetric reflectors that direct light away from your eyes and screen.
Physical adjustability determines how effectively you can position the light source. Evaluate the range of motion of the lamp head and arm, looking for multi-axis joints that allow you to adjust the height and angle to prevent casting shadows from your hands or body onto your work.
Color temperature, measured in Kelvin (K), is another key setting to check. Many modern study lamps offer adjustable color temperatures, allowing you to switch between a cool white light (around 5000K) for active focus and a warmer, softer light (around 3000K) for evening reading. This is a matter of personal preference, but having the option to adjust it can help customize your study environment.
Philips: Established Ergonomics and Eye-Care Focus
Philips has long been a household name in Singapore, known for its focus on reliable, eye-care-oriented lighting solutions. Their study-oriented desk lamps typically feature specialized diffusion technologies, such as honeycomb lenses or micro-prism arrays, designed to scatter light evenly and minimize harsh, direct glare. This design philosophy prioritizes a soft, comfortable visual environment that mimics natural light.

In terms of build quality, Philips lamps often utilize robust plastics and sturdy metal joints that provide reliable stability on your desk. Their ergonomic models frequently feature flexible silicone necks or multi-jointed arms, allowing you to pivot the light source precisely where it is needed without the lamp tipping over. Many of their designs cater to traditional study setups with simple, tactile physical buttons that are easy to operate.
When purchasing a Philips table light in Singapore, always verify the local electrical specifications on the box. Ensure the model is rated for Singapore’s 230V, 50Hz power supply and carries the Enterprise Singapore Safety Mark. Additionally, check the rated lifetime of the integrated LED module and confirm the maximum wattage limit to ensure safe, long-term operation.
Xiaomi: Smart Integration and Minimalist Value
Xiaomi has gained popularity by offering modern, minimalist designs integrated with smart home capabilities at highly competitive price points. Their table lights typically connect to home automation ecosystems via Wi-Fi or Bluetooth, allowing you to adjust brightness, customize color temperatures, and set automated study schedules directly from your smartphone or via voice commands.
The aesthetic of Xiaomi lamps is characterized by clean lines, slim profiles, and a compact footprint. This makes them particularly well-suited for smaller study desks, shared bedrooms, or modern HDB apartments where space is at a premium. The minimalist physical interface usually consists of a single dial or touch button, leaving advanced adjustments to the mobile app.
However, before choosing a Xiaomi lamp for intensive studying, you must verify its optical specifications. Ensure the specific model you are considering is rated for dedicated reading tasks rather than just ambient lighting. Check the packaging to confirm it delivers sufficient lux at desk level and possesses a high CRI rating, as some entry-level smart models may prioritize connectivity over high-performance optical output.
BenQ: Premium Optical Engineering and Wide Coverage
BenQ positions its table lights at the premium end of the market, focusing heavily on advanced optical engineering to solve common study-space challenges. Their flagship desk lamps often feature a distinctive curved head design, which is engineered to project a wide, highly uniform arc of light across your entire workspace, making them ideal for larger desks.
A key feature of BenQ’s optical design is asymmetric light projection. This technology directs light at an angle to illuminate your desk surface while preventing direct reflections off computer screens or tablet displays. This makes their lamps highly suitable for modern study environments that involve a mix of physical textbooks and digital screens.
Many premium BenQ models also feature built-in ambient light sensors that automatically detect surrounding light levels and suggest real-time brightness adjustments. This helps maintain a consistent level of illumination on your desk as daylight fades, reducing the need for manual adjustments.
Before investing in a BenQ lamp, verify the physical requirements of your setup. These premium lamps often have a larger footprint or require specialized clamp mounts, so you must check your desk’s edge thickness and material compatibility. Additionally, confirm the power adapter specifications and ensure your workspace can accommodate the physical range of motion of their heavy-duty, counterbalanced arms.
Comparing Core Features Across the Three Brands
To help you evaluate your options, the following matrix outlines the typical characteristics of each brand across key decision-making dimensions. Use this comparison as a baseline when browsing online marketplaces or visiting local retail showrooms in Singapore.
| Brand | Typical Design Focus | Smart Ecosystem Integration | Ideal Desk Size | Key Label Checks |
|---|---|---|---|---|
| Philips | Soft, diffused light with honeycomb lenses | Minimal to moderate (model-dependent) | Small to medium | Safety Mark, rated LED lifetime, lux levels |
| Xiaomi | Minimalist aesthetics and smart automation | High (app control, scheduling, scenes) | Small to medium | CRI rating, maximum lux output, wireless protocol |
| BenQ | Asymmetric optical path and wide coverage | Low to moderate (auto-dimming sensors) | Medium to large | Clamp compatibility, desk footprint, power specs |

Decision Framework: Which Brand Fits Your Study Setup?
Choosing the right brand depends on your physical study environment, your daily habits, and how you interact with your workspace. If you prioritize a straightforward, plug-and-play setup with proven physical ergonomics and soft, glare-free light, Philips is a highly reliable choice. Their lamps are ideal for traditional study setups focused primarily on reading and writing physical materials.
If you are working with a limited budget, appreciate minimalist aesthetics, and want to integrate your lighting into a broader smart home ecosystem, Xiaomi offers excellent value. Just be sure to verify that the specific model’s brightness and color rendering capabilities meet the demands of your study routine.
For those who use large desks, dual-monitor setups, or spend long hours switching between physical textbooks and digital screens, BenQ’s premium optical engineering justifies the higher investment. The wide, asymmetric light distribution is highly effective at reducing screen glare and illuminating expansive workspaces.
Before finalizing your purchase, always measure your desk space, check for specific mounting constraints (such as glass tabletops or thick bevels), and ensure the lamp’s electrical certifications align with local safety standards. If you have specific visual sensitivities or medical lighting requirements, consult an eye-care professional before selecting a light source.
Frequently Asked Questions (FAQ)
Does a higher wattage always mean a better study table light?
No, a higher wattage does not automatically mean a better study light. Wattage simply measures electrical power consumption, not the quality or brightness of the light produced. Modern LED technology is highly efficient, meaning a low-wattage LED lamp can produce the same or greater brightness (measured in lumens) as an older, high-wattage bulb. When evaluating a study lamp, focus on the lux rating (which measures light intensity on your desk surface) and the uniformity of light distribution rather than the wattage.
Can I use a standard smart bulb in any desk lamp for studying?
While you can physically fit a smart bulb into many standard desk lamps, it may not provide an optimal study environment. Standard bulbs often lack the specialized optical diffusers or asymmetric reflectors found in dedicated study lamps, which can lead to harsh glare and uneven light distribution. If you choose to retrofit a lamp, always verify the lamp’s maximum wattage rating, ensure the physical enclosure allows for adequate heat dissipation, and check that the lamp shade provides sufficient glare control to protect your eyes during long reading sessions.
